Unity, Wis. - Aug. 27, 1942

Miss Mayme Yahr left Friday for Sioux City, Iowa, after having spent the summer with her sister in Unity, Wis.

The Oak Grove school in the town of Unity opened Monday with Miss Marie Van Slett as teacher.

Mr. and Mrs. Joseph Jordan of Mellen were the guests of Mr. and Mrs. Frank Jordan Friday.

Mr. and Mrs. Arthur Steinke and son, Dale, spent the week-end at Milwaukee and attended the state fair.

The Unity school will open for the school year on Tuesday, Sept. 8th.

Mr. and Mrs. Ray Hause of Milwaukee are spending the week with the former’s parents, Mr. and Mrs. Sam Hause.

Mr. and Mrs. E. J. Feit and daughter, Jean, spent Sunday at Abbotsford where they attended a family reunion of the Mrs. John Olson family on her seventy-first birthday anniversary. Forty people were present.

Miss Dorothy Cook of Wausau spent the week-end at her home in Unity, Wis.

Principal and Mrs. Parsons and two children have moved into the house vacated by Mr. and Mrs. Bob Olson.

Mrs. Gust Ringquist, who has been suffering from hay fever, is spending three weeks at Stone Lake.
